Question 124

Work out the surface area of the following shape.

Open in App
Solution

In the given figure, there is a cube of side 5 cm and a cylinder of height 20 cm and radius is 2 cm
So, total surface area = Surface area of the cube + Curved surface area of cylinder
=6(5)2+2π(2)×20
=150+80π [surface area of cube=6a2surface area of cylinder=2πrh]
=150+80π
Total surface area =150+251.2=401.2 cm2
